Summer of MO Music

Things are heating up, and The Montclair Orchestra is excited for two chamber programs this summer at the Morris Museum in Morristown, as we get back into the swing of things!


Strings of Summer

Jul 25, 8:00pm 
Morris Museum, 6 Normandy Hgts. Rd., Morristown, NJ

Join as at the Morris Museum on July 25th for part of the summer concert series! A sextet of MO strings will be performing a program with music by Richard Strauss, Antonin Dvorak, and Morristown-Beard School graduate Kailyn Williams, with her NJMTA winning composition Silver Bells and Golden Sand!

Julia Choi, Violin / Letian Cheng, Violin / Dov Scheindlin, Viola / Jiawei Yan, Viola / Julia Bruskin, Cello / Isaiah Pennington, Cello

Percussive Harmony

Aug 1, 8:00pm 
Morris Museum, 6 Normandy Hgts. Rd., Morristown, NJ

MO percussionists will be presenting a hugely fun and diverse program at the Morris Museum on August 1st! Expect the unexpected in this program spanning Vivaldi to Joplin and everything in between.
